Editorial guidelines

  • Season length: 6-12 episodes. Limited run. 
  • Editorial focus: For this content callout, we are specifically looking to tell the stories of women. This could be a narrative that centres on a woman/women, a story told from the perspective of a woman/women, a story that feels particularly relevant for women, or something else. These women do not have to be heroes and they certainly do not have to be perfect. We are looking to tell multifaceted, authentic stories.
  • A story: We’re inviting pitches for a story or a narrative, not a topic. The podcast needs to take us on a journey that involves twists and turns and introduces us to some key characters that we can root for (or against!). Please be aware that we are not able to work with you on a live investigation. The story will also need to have some sort of conclusion when you pitch it to us.
  • Audience: This series idea should attract a large, international audience of podcast listeners who are on the hunt for their next non-fiction, binge-worthy series. 
  • Originality: This series idea needs to break new ground. It can’t have already been told in the media (ie. TV or film) or, if it has, you’ll need to provide an angle that feels totally new. It cannot have been told in podcast format and it cannot have been pitched to a podcast platform previously.

About Mags Creative 

Mags Creative is a multi-award winning UK podcast production and promotion agency. Founded by sisters Hannah and Faith Russell in 2018, we were awarded the Best Network at the British Podcast Awards 2022. 

Reaching millions of ears, Mags Creative works with brands such as Puffin, Meta, Google, Carolina Herrera, Duke of Edinburgh and Red Bull to produce and promote podcasts globally. Talent partnerships include the likes of Jonny Wilkinson (I AM…), Kate Ferdinand (Blended) and Laura Whitmore (Castaway). Platform partners include Spotify, Amazon Music, the BBC and Podimo.

Shows produced by Mags Creative frequently top the Apple charts, and are featured by Spotify, Apple and Amazon. They also achieve high profile media coverage in titles such as the London Evening Standard, Stylist and The Guardian.
